Subtract whole numbers (written strategies) - No regrouping
Theory
To subtract whole numbers, line them up by place value with the larger number on top and subtract each column, starting from the ones. When every top digit is big enough, no borrowing is needed — subtraction without regrouping.
The subtraction algorithm takes one number away from another by writing them in columns, larger number on top.
Subtract each column from the right — top digit minus bottom digit — and write each answer underneath.
When every top digit is big enough, no borrowing is needed. This is subtraction without regrouping.
Set the numbers out so every digit sits in its place-value column, larger number on top.

How to subtract without regrouping
- Write the larger number on top, ones under ones.
- Subtract each column from the right: top digit minus bottom digit.
- Write each answer underneath to build the difference.

Frequently asked questions
How do you subtract large numbers?
Write them in columns with the larger number on top, then subtract each column from the right: top digit minus bottom digit.
What does subtracting without regrouping mean?
Every top digit is big enough to take the bottom digit from, so you never need to borrow. \(7856 - 3421 = 4435\).
Which number goes on top?
The larger number, the one you are subtracting from, goes on top. You take the bottom number away from it.
Why do you start from the ones?
Working right to left keeps each digit in its place and prepares you for subtractions that do need borrowing.
